Actually, by those definitions, they are not the same.

There is a clear distinction between a comment, in the sense that it is a specific observation or remark, vs a review which is an evaluation and thus is much larger in scope. Also, a review is explicitly and inherently critical, whilst a comment is not. If nothing else, there are very well established connotations of both words, defined by their typical usage. Even if you don't go into a proper analysis to demonstrate that the words do mean different things, the simple concept of the level of detail implied by either word should be a given.

The blank reviews are based upon the idea that tagging counts as a "review" I think. Which in some ways is good, as it means that taggings can be rated up and down, adding to their weight which should certainly help with the search filtering. Though I don't see why uprating tags couldn't have been separate...
